אוּץ
ʼûwts · ootsHebrew · H213
Derivation
a primitive root;
Meaning
to press; (by implication) to be close, hurry, withdraw
In the King James Version
(make) haste(-n, -y), labor, be narrow.
Translated as
hastened (2), hasted (2), hasty (2), hasteth (1), haste (1), labour (1)
Where it appears
Found in 9 verses
